    Ever wondered what makes a bed worth over $10,000? Dive into the world of Hästens, a Swedish brand crafting incredible beds with natural materials like horsehair and wool for ultimate sleep quality. You'll pick up fascinating vocabulary about luxury craftsmanship and discover why these handcrafted beds come with a 25-year warranty!
